Verdict

The Teclast M8 (3GB + 32GB) is an 8.4-inch Android tablet featuring a high-resolution 2.5K (2560 x 1600) JDI IPS display with a 4:3 aspect ratio, powered by an Allwinner A63 quad-core processor clocked at 1.8GHz and a Mali-T760 GPU. Encased in a thin 7.4mm all-metal body weighing approximately 354g, it includes a 4800mAh battery, dual-band WiFi, Bluetooth 4.0, and versatile connectivity via USB Type-C and Micro HDMI. Main advantages include its exceptionally sharp screen for reading and media consumption, independent HiFi power amplifier for improved audio, and a lightweight, premium-feel design; however, notable drawbacks include its aging Android 7.1 operating system, modest 2.0MP rear and 0.3MP front cameras, and a lack of built-in GPS or cellular support.

Third-party reviews

What customers like about Teclast M8 WiFi (3GB + 32GB)?

  • High-resolution 8.4-inch display (2560 x 1600) providing sharp visuals for reading and streaming
  • Excellent build quality with a metal unibody that feels premium in hand
  • Loud dual speakers suitable for media consumption
  • Affordable price point offering high specs compared to major competitors
  • Compact and lightweight design, making it highly portable for travel

What customers dislike about Teclast M8 WiFi (3GB + 32GB)?

  • Lack of GPS unit and gyroscope, limiting its use for navigation or certain games
  • Underwhelming battery life, often failing to meet the manufacturer's 7-hour claim under heavy use
  • Slow charging times, taking upwards of 3 to 3.5 hours for a full charge
  • Poor camera quality, especially the rear sensor which produces pixelated or grainy images
  • Difficulty finding compatible accessories like dedicated protective cases
